What does an assistant machine operator do?

An assistant grinding machine operator supports the main operator by preparing materials, setting up equipment, and monitoring the grinding process to ensure quality and safety. They may also perform routine maintenance and assist with troubleshooting equipment issues in a manufacturing or industrial environment.

What is the difference between Assistant Grinding Machine Operator vs Machine Operator?

The main difference between an Assistant Grinding Machine Operator and a Machine Operator lies in responsibility level. Assistants support the operation by preparing equipment and performing basic tasks, while Machine Operators handle the full operation and control of grinding machines. Both roles typically require similar credentials and work in similar environments, but the Machine Operator has greater independence and technical responsibility.

What machine operator pays the most?

Among machine operators, those working as CNC (Computer Numerical Control) machine operators or in specialized manufacturing environments tend to have higher salaries due to technical skills and certifications. Experience, industry, and location also influence pay, with roles in aerospace, automotive, and precision manufacturing generally offering higher wages.

Altium Packaging is one of the largest plastic container companies and suppliers of rigid plastic packaging. We specialize in customized mid- and short-run packaging solutions and serve a diverse customer base in the pharmaceutical, dairy, household chemicals, food/nutraceuticals, industrial/specialty chemicals, water, and beverage/juice segments.

We are currently seeking an experienced Machine Operator in Bessemer. As a Machine Operator, you will operate blow mold, grinder and trimmer machines, as well as the conveyor system. You will also troubleshoot process problems and perform minor maintenance to ensure continued operation of the production line. Being a team player will be essential since all tasks require close collaboration with co-workers. Your goal is to ensure that procedures are carried out smoothly to maximize both efficiency and profits.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Ensure compliance with corporate and plant safety standards and with applicable laws and regulations issued by regulatory agencies

  • Set up machines (calibration, cleaning, etc.) to start a production cycle

  • Control and adjust machine settings (e.g., speed)

  • Operate blow-mold machines (including wheels, reciprocator or shuttle machines)

  • Perform audits, weights and quality checks

  • Check output to spot any machine-related mistakes or flaws

  • Keep records of approved and defective units or final products

  • Enter data into SPC database for quality control measures

  • Troubleshoot, preventative maintenance, minor repair on blow mold & support equipment

  • Repair or replace pneumatic and hydraulic lines

  • Maintain activity logs

REQUIREMENTS:

  • High school diploma or equivalent

  • 2+ years' experience as a machine operator

  • Working knowledge of diverse high-speed machinery and measurement tools (caliper, micrometer etc.)

  • Strong mechanical aptitude and analytical skills are required

  • Machine maintenance experience

  • Ability to read blueprints, schematics and manuals

  • Ability to work overtime

  • Physical stamina and strength/able to stand for long periods of time
